The Fats Domino Tribute is headed by pianist/singer Eric-Jan Overbeek, also known as Mr. Boogie Woogie who was a 13-year old when he found himself in the grip of ‘the boogie-woogie’ after listening to Fats Domino’s ‘Swanee River Hop’.
Meanwhile, over 30 years later, he tours through America three months a year, received numerous national and international awards and in 2010 performed the opening act with his band on the 35th edition of the North Sea Jazzfestival.
